differentiate between emulsion,foam and gel​

Answer:

Emulsion:

A colloidal solution in which both the dispersed phase and dispersion medium are liquids is called an Emulsion.

Gel:

Gels is that kind of colloid in which the dispersed phase is a liquid and the dispersion medium is a solid.

Foam:

Foam is a substance in which the particles are gas bubbles and the medium is a liquid.
